    Goals / Remit

    Fortescue is a global metals and green energy company, recognised for its culture, innovation and industry-leading development of infrastructure, mining assets and green energy initiatives. It operates with two divisions – Metals and Energy. Fortescue Energy is comprised of Fortescue Future Industries (FFI) and WAE Technologies. FFI is committed to producing green hydrogen, containing zero carbon, from renewable electricity. Fortescue is acquiring and developing technology solutions for hard-to-decarbonise industries, while building a global portfolio of renewable green hydrogen and green ammonia projects. Fortescue is developing and acquiring the technology and energy supply to help decarbonise the Australian iron ore operations of one of the world’s largest producers of iron ore, Fortescue Metals, by 2030 (Scope 1 and 2 terrestrial emissions). We have published a fully costed roadmap and plan to achieve this.

    Main EU files targeted

    Fortescue aligns with the EU's proposals and policies, most notably with regard to climate neutrality and economic growth. We support the Commission's proposals with regard to renewable hydrogen in FitFor55 and REPowerEU, and are following the development of related files such as
    - the Critical Raw Materials Act
    - Net Zero Industries Act
    - the Hydrogen and Decarbonised Gas Market package
    - the development of a certification system for renewable hydrogen
    - Development of the European Hydrogen Bank

    Other financial info

    Our flagship green ammonia plant, 'FFI Holmaneset' has been selected in July 2025 by the Innovation Fund for a grant for Innovative electrification in industry and hydrogen.

    The Holmaneset project is a great opportunity for FFI, Norway and Europe for early development of a significant green energy value chain, and we commend the EU for its leadership in kickstarting a green ammonia industry.

    We look forward to finalising the details of our arrangements with the European Climate, Infrastructure and Environment Executive Agency (CINEA) in due course.

    Meetings

    7 meetings found. Download meetings

    The list below only covers meetings held since November 2014 with commissioners, their cabinet members or directors-general at the European Commission; other lobby meetings with lower-level staff may have taken place, but the European Commission doesn't proactively publish information about these meetings. For more information about which commissioner is responsible for which portfolio, check out this link: https://commissioners.ec.europa.eu/index_en All information below comes from European Commission web pages.
